Understanding Gambling Addiction

Gambling addiction, often referred to as compulsive gambling, is a serious condition that affects many individuals worldwide. It is characterized by an uncontrollable urge to gamble despite the negative consequences that may arise. This addiction can lead to devastating outcomes not only for the individual but also for their families and communities. Recognizing the signs early can help initiate the recovery process and reclaim control over one’s life. The psychology behind gambling addiction often intertwines with emotional and psychological factors. Many individuals gamble to escape from stress, anxiety, or depression, creating a vicious cycle that can be hard to break. Understanding these emotional triggers is vital for anyone who suspects they or someone they know may be struggling with this issue.

Identifying the Warning Signs

Several signs may indicate a problem with gambling. Individuals may find themselves preoccupied with thoughts of gambling, often leading to neglect of personal and professional responsibilities. If gambling activities begin to interfere with daily life, this could signal the onset of addiction. Moreover, lying about gambling habits or borrowing money to gamble are also common indicators that someone may need help.

Emotional symptoms can also arise, such as irritability when trying to cut back or stop gambling. This emotional turmoil can exacerbate the situation, making it increasingly difficult for individuals to recognize their condition or seek help. Addressing these signs early is crucial for effective intervention.

The Impact of Gambling Addiction

The consequences of gambling addiction can be severe and far-reaching. Financial instability is often the most visible result, as individuals may incur significant debts or lose savings. This financial strain can lead to additional stress and impact relationships with family and friends. As the addiction progresses, the social stigma associated with gambling can further isolate the individual, creating a cycle of loneliness and despair.

Moreover, gambling addiction can have a profound effect on mental health. Individuals may experience heightened levels of anxiety, depression, or even suicidal thoughts as they grapple with the fallout from their addiction. It is crucial to understand that help is available and recovery is possible with the right support and resources.

Steps to Reclaim Control

Reclaiming control from gambling addiction requires a multifaceted approach. The first step often involves acknowledging the problem and committing to change. Seeking support from loved ones, professional counseling, or support groups can provide the necessary encouragement and resources. Understanding that recovery is a journey, not a destination, can help individuals remain patient and committed.

Setting realistic goals and developing healthier coping mechanisms is also essential. This may involve finding alternative activities that provide fulfillment or joy, such as hobbies or physical exercise. Establishing a strong support network can significantly increase the chances of successful recovery, as sharing experiences with others who understand can provide immense comfort.
